The process involves creating a warm emulsified butter sauce. It traditionally begins with a reduction of vinegar or white wine, shallots, and peppercorns. This reduction is then whisked vigorously while cold butter is gradually incorporated, resulting in a rich, velvety sauce.

This classic sauce is highly valued in culinary arts due to its delicate flavor and versatility. It enhances various dishes, particularly seafood, poultry, and vegetables, adding a luxurious touch. Its origins can be traced back to French cuisine, where it remains a staple.

1. Reduction

In the context of this classic sauce preparation, the reduction serves as the flavor foundation. It typically involves simmering an acidic liquid, such as white wine or vinegar, combined with aromatics like shallots and peppercorns. The primary objective is to concentrate the flavors by evaporating excess liquid, resulting in a more intense and complex base. Without proper reduction, the final sauce lacks depth and the acidity may be overpowering. For example, a wine reduction that has not sufficiently reduced will yield a thin sauce with a harsh alcoholic taste, undermining the desired delicate flavor profile.

The reduction also plays a critical role in the stability of the emulsion. The concentrated acids help to keep the butterfat molecules dispersed within the liquid, preventing them from separating. The correct consistency of the reduction is paramount. If it is too watery, the butter will not emulsify properly, leading to a broken sauce. Conversely, if the reduction is over-reduced and becomes syrupy, the final product may be excessively thick and lack the desired lightness. Professional kitchens rely on specific visual cues, such as the liquid coating the back of a spoon, to determine the appropriate reduction level.

Mastery of the reduction process is therefore essential for success. A well-executed reduction provides the necessary acidity, flavor intensity, and emulsifying properties, leading to a balanced and stable sauce. Achieving the proper reduction level is a fundamental challenge, but understanding the underlying principles and practicing visual assessment techniques are key to consistently producing a high-quality finished product. The reduction is therefore a critical step in the pursuit of culinary excellence.

2. Cold Butter

The temperature of the butter is a crucial factor in achieving a stable and desirable emulsion in the preparation of this sauce. Cold butter, typically cut into small cubes, is gradually incorporated into the reduction while whisking constantly. This controlled introduction of cold butter is essential for preventing the sauce from breaking.

  • Emulsification Process

    Cold butter melts slowly when added to the warm reduction, allowing the fat molecules to disperse evenly and create a stable emulsion. If the butter is too warm, it melts too quickly, overwhelming the reduction and causing the sauce to separate. The controlled melting process provided by cold butter ensures that the fat and liquid components bind together properly.

  • Temperature Differential

    The temperature difference between the warm reduction and the cold butter is critical. This differential helps to create the necessary shear force during whisking, which breaks down the butterfat into smaller globules and suspends them in the liquid. A smaller temperature differential, such as using lukewarm butter, diminishes the shear force and hinders the emulsification process.

  • Butter Composition

    The fat content and overall composition of the butter also play a role. High-quality butter with a high fat percentage contributes to a richer and more stable emulsion. Clarified butter, from which milk solids have been removed, is sometimes preferred because the milk solids can interfere with the emulsion and increase the risk of separation. However, using whole butter offers a richer flavour profile that some prefer.

  • Stabilizing the Sauce

    Introducing cold butter incrementally and maintaining a constant whisking motion helps to stabilize the sauce. The cold butter cools the reduction slightly, preventing it from overheating and causing the emulsion to break. Continuous whisking provides the necessary agitation to keep the fat and liquid components properly mixed, ensuring a smooth and velvety texture.

The strategic use of cold butter, therefore, is a cornerstone of successful preparation. By managing the butter’s temperature and incorporation, the cook can create a stable and flavorful sauce that elevates the dish it accompanies. An understanding of this relationship is essential for culinary precision and consistent results.

3. Emulsification

Emulsification is the linchpin in the creation of this classic sauce. It represents the process of suspending two immiscible liquids, in this case, melted butter (fat) and a water-based reduction (acidic liquid), into a stable, homogenous mixture. Without proper emulsification, the sauce will separate, resulting in an undesirable, oily consistency.

  • The Role of Agitation

    Agitation, typically achieved through vigorous whisking, provides the mechanical energy necessary to break down the butterfat into minuscule globules. These globules are then dispersed throughout the liquid reduction. Continuous whisking is crucial to prevent the fat molecules from coalescing, which would lead to separation. Examples of insufficient agitation include intermittent whisking or using a utensil that doesn’t effectively disperse the fat. The resultant sauce will exhibit an oily film on the surface, indicating a failure of the emulsification process.

  • The Influence of Temperature

    Temperature plays a critical role in maintaining the stability of the emulsion. The reduction must be warm enough to melt the butter but not so hot as to cause the emulsion to break. Excessive heat will destabilize the proteins and other emulsifiers present, leading to separation. Maintaining a consistent, moderate temperature is therefore paramount. In practice, this often involves removing the pan from direct heat periodically to prevent overheating.

  • The Contribution of Acid

    The acidity of the reduction helps to stabilize the emulsion. Acidic compounds, such as those found in wine or vinegar, assist in preventing the butterfat molecules from clumping together. This is achieved by influencing the electrical charges on the surface of the fat globules. If the reduction lacks sufficient acidity, the emulsion will be less stable and more prone to separation. The appropriate balance of acid is thus crucial for achieving a long-lasting, homogenous sauce.

  • The Impact of Butter Composition

    The composition of the butter itself affects the ease and stability of emulsification. Butter with a higher fat content tends to emulsify more readily. Additionally, clarified butter, which has had its milk solids removed, can contribute to a smoother, more stable emulsion. Milk solids can sometimes interfere with the emulsification process, increasing the risk of separation. The choice of butter therefore impacts the final texture and stability of the sauce.

The complexities of emulsification are central to the success of this elegant sauce. Each element – agitation, temperature, acidity, and butter composition – must be carefully controlled to achieve the desired velvety texture and prevent separation. Understanding these principles enables the creation of a consistently superior accompaniment.

4. Temperature

Maintaining precise temperature control throughout the preparation is paramount. It directly influences the emulsion’s stability, the sauce’s texture, and overall flavor profile. Deviations can result in a broken sauce, an undesirable consistency, or a compromised taste.

  • Reduction Temperature

    The reduction should be maintained at a gentle simmer. Excessive heat can cause the reduction to evaporate too quickly, potentially leading to an overly concentrated or even burnt base. Conversely, insufficient heat will not allow the flavors to concentrate adequately, resulting in a weak and watery foundation. The visual cue of small bubbles gently breaking the surface is indicative of the appropriate temperature. This ensures proper flavor concentration without scorching.

  • Butter Incorporation Temperature

    The butter must be added cold, but the reduction cannot be so cold as to prevent melting and emulsification. The ideal temperature range allows for a gradual melting of the butterfat, facilitating the formation of a stable emulsion. Adding butter that is too warm will cause it to melt too quickly and separate, while adding it to a reduction that is too cool will hinder emulsification entirely. The sauce may then appear greasy or separated.

  • Emulsification Temperature

    The emulsification process itself requires a specific temperature range to maintain stability. The sauce should be warm enough to keep the butter melted and dispersed, but not so hot as to cause the emulsion to break. This delicate balance is often achieved by removing the pan from direct heat intermittently while whisking. The texture is indicative of the proper temperature; a smooth, velvety consistency signals success, while a grainy or separated appearance indicates that the temperature is either too high or too low.

  • Holding Temperature

    Even after the sauce is emulsified, maintaining the correct holding temperature is critical. The sauce should be kept warm, but not allowed to boil. Holding it at too low a temperature can cause the emulsion to break over time, while boiling will result in separation and an altered flavor profile. A bain-marie or a very low heat setting are often employed to maintain the desired holding temperature until service, preserving the sauce’s texture and stability.

These temperature considerations are interdependent and collectively determine the success of the sauce. Precise management of temperature is not merely a technical detail but a fundamental requirement for achieving the desired characteristics of the final product. Success is found with continuous monitoring and careful adjustments throughout preparation.

6. Clarified Butter

The use of clarified butter in the preparation can be a strategic choice, offering specific advantages over whole butter. Clarification involves removing water and milk solids from whole butter, leaving behind pure butterfat. This process influences the final texture and stability of the emulsion. The presence of milk solids in whole butter can sometimes interfere with the emulsification process, increasing the risk of separation, particularly when temperature control is not precise. Clarified butter, devoid of these solids, allows for a smoother and more stable emulsion, resulting in a silkier sauce. Consider a scenario where meticulous temperature management is challenging; clarified butter provides a greater margin for error, reducing the likelihood of the sauce breaking.

However, the choice between clarified and whole butter is not solely about stability. Whole butter contributes a richer, more complex flavor profile due to the presence of milk solids. While clarified butter yields a cleaner, more refined taste, it lacks the depth and nutty undertones that whole butter can impart. The decision depends on the desired flavor outcome and the cook’s level of expertise. For example, a chef aiming for a classic, intensely flavored might opt for whole butter, accepting the increased risk of separation and employing precise temperature control to mitigate it. Conversely, a less experienced cook might choose clarified butter to ensure a stable emulsion, prioritizing texture over maximum flavor complexity.

Ultimately, understanding the properties of both clarified and whole butter allows for informed decision-making in the creation of the sauce. While clarified butter offers enhanced stability and a smoother texture, whole butter provides a richer, more complex flavor. The selection depends on the desired outcome, the cook’s skill level, and the specific ingredients being paired with the sauce. This choice is therefore not merely a matter of technique, but a consideration of the desired sensory experience and the technical constraints of the culinary environment.

7. Seasoning

Seasoning plays a critical role in the final expression of a perfectly prepared sauce. While the emulsification and texture are essential technical achievements, appropriate seasoning elevates the sauce from a technically sound emulsion to a flavorful culinary component. Salt is the primary seasoning agent, enhancing the inherent flavors of the reduction and butter. The addition of freshly ground white pepper contributes a subtle warmth and complexity, complementing the richness of the sauce. Over-salting can mask the delicate flavors, while under-salting renders the sauce bland and uninteresting. A small squeeze of lemon juice can add brightness and acidity, further balancing the richness. For instance, when serving with delicate white fish, a judicious use of lemon can prevent the sauce from overpowering the fish’s subtle flavor.

The timing of seasoning is also a crucial consideration. Ideally, seasoning should occur gradually throughout the process, allowing the flavors to meld and develop. A small amount of salt is typically added to the reduction to enhance the aromatics. The sauce is then tasted and adjusted as necessary after the butter has been fully incorporated. This allows for a more nuanced understanding of the flavor profile as it evolves. Some chefs may incorporate finely chopped fresh herbs, such as chives or parsley, as a final touch, adding a visual and aromatic dimension. However, these additions should be used sparingly to avoid overwhelming the delicate balance of flavors.

In conclusion, seasoning is not an afterthought but an integral step. It requires a keen understanding of flavor interactions and a delicate touch. Proper seasoning amplifies the sauces inherent qualities, transforming it into a harmonious and complementary element of the dish. Achieving optimal seasoning is a continuous process of tasting and adjusting, demanding focus and culinary intuition. The successful execution of this step ensures a memorable and satisfying culinary experience.

Frequently Asked Questions

The following addresses common inquiries regarding the preparation of this classic emulsified butter sauce, offering clarity on technique and troubleshooting advice.

Question 1: Why does the sauce separate during preparation?

Sauce separation typically arises from improper temperature control or an unstable emulsion. Overheating or insufficient whisking during butter incorporation can cause the emulsion to break, resulting in a greasy or oily consistency.

Question 2: Can alternative liquids be used in place of white wine vinegar?

While white wine vinegar is traditional, other acidic liquids, such as lemon juice or verjus, may be substituted. However, these alternatives will alter the flavor profile of the sauce and should be selected with consideration for the accompanying dish.

Question 3: What is the ideal consistency of the reduction before adding the butter?

The reduction should achieve a syrupy consistency, coating the back of a spoon. If the reduction is too watery, the emulsion will not form properly. If it is too thick, the sauce may become overly concentrated and lack its characteristic lightness.

Question 4: How can the sauce be reheated without causing it to break?

Reheating should be done gently over very low heat or in a bain-marie. Avoid direct heat, as it can easily cause the emulsion to separate. Whisking continuously during reheating may help to maintain the emulsion’s stability.

Question 5: Is clarified butter essential for achieving a stable emulsion?

While clarified butter can enhance stability by removing milk solids, it is not strictly essential. Whole butter can be used successfully with careful temperature control and diligent whisking. The choice depends on the desired flavor profile and the cook’s level of experience.

Question 6: What are some common flavor variations?

Variations may include the addition of fresh herbs, such as chives or tarragon, or spices, such as saffron or fennel seeds. These additions should be used sparingly to complement, not overpower, the delicate flavors of the sauce.

Tips to Make Beurre Blanc

Achieving a stable and flavorful requires attention to detail throughout the entire process. These guidelines are designed to improve technique and prevent common errors.

Tip 1: Begin with High-Quality Ingredients: The flavor is largely dependent on the quality of the butter and reduction base. Use unsalted butter with a high fat content and select a wine or vinegar that offers a clean, bright acidity.

Tip 2: Ensure Proper Reduction: The reduction should be syrupy and coat the back of a spoon. An under-reduced liquid will lead to a thin, unstable sauce, while an over-reduced liquid may become too concentrated and bitter.

Tip 3: Incorporate Cold Butter Gradually: Introduce small, cold cubes of butter into the warm reduction, whisking continuously. This gradual incorporation is crucial for achieving a stable emulsion. Overly rapid melting of the butter will cause the sauce to separate.

Tip 4: Maintain Consistent Whisking: Continuous and vigorous whisking is necessary to disperse the butterfat and prevent the emulsion from breaking. Ceasing whisking, even briefly, can disrupt the emulsification process.

Tip 5: Monitor Temperature Carefully: The sauce should be warm enough to melt the butter but not so hot as to cause the emulsion to separate. Removing the pan from direct heat intermittently can help regulate temperature. Overheating is a primary cause of sauce failure.

Tip 6: Season Judiciously: Seasoning should be incremental, allowing the flavors to meld and develop throughout the process. Over-seasoning can mask the delicate flavors, while under-seasoning will result in a bland sauce.

Tip 7: Consider Using Clarified Butter: Clarified butter, which has had its milk solids removed, may enhance the stability of the sauce, particularly for less experienced cooks. Whole butter, however, offers a richer flavor profile.
